Transaction 86cfded34b1efb53a2e3e9ef92b67969c467eaff38040fcb70748aaab52bac7d
1 Input
1 Output
-
86cfded34b1efb53a2e3e9ef92b67969c467eaff38040fcb70748aaab52bac7d:0
- value
- 26232112
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 526770b50fbd9e5e61bef6fa544ac3a67c84630b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18WiKtMzk6xixMN1JGdE5ozcnF86FRYLXm